Most videocard manufacturers provide software utilities on their website.

By far one of the better GPU utilities is MSI Afterburner, though pretty much the only difference between it and say, EVGA Precision, is that the latter does not offer voltage modification.

You don't have to overclock or anything if you don't want to, but they offer full real-time graphs that monitor:
Utilization, Temperature, Fan speed, clockrate changes, etc.

Both those programs are based on Rivatuner, so I'm pretty sure they are compatible with just about any GPU, but it can be easier to use a more official one that focuses on your chipset.
